La importancia de las politicas de IAM en la seguridad de AWS

Las políticas de IAM son vitales en la gestión de la seguridad en AWS debido a su papel central en la definición de los permisos que controlan el acceso a los recursos y servicios de AWS. La importancia de las políticas de IAM y su relación con las vulnerabilidades críticas se debe a varias razones clave:

  1. Control de Acceso: Las políticas de IAM determinan quién puede hacer qué dentro de una cuenta de AWS. Una política mal configurada puede conceder accidentalmente acceso excesivo a usuarios o servicios, lo que podría llevar a la exposición de datos sensibles o la modificación indebida de la infraestructura.

  2. Principio de Mínimo Privilegio: Una práctica esencial en la seguridad es otorgar el mínimo nivel de acceso necesario para realizar una tarea. Las políticas de IAM que no siguen este principio pueden otorgar permisos excesivos que pueden ser explotados por atacantes para escalar privilegios o acceder a recursos restringidos.

  3. Auditoría y Conformidad: Las políticas de IAM juegan un papel crucial en la auditoría y el cumplimiento normativo. Políticas inadecuadas o permisos demasiado permisivos pueden resultar en incumplimiento de regulaciones de seguridad y privacidad de datos, lo que puede llevar a sanciones y daños a la reputación.

  4. Automatización y Errores de Configuración: En entornos donde se emplea la automatización para desplegar y gestionar recursos, un error en la configuración de las políticas de IAM puede propagarse rápidamente, aumentando el riesgo de vulnerabilidades.

  5. Exposición a Ataques de Fuerza Bruta y Phishing: Las credenciales débiles o políticas que permiten demasiados intentos de autenticación pueden hacer a las cuentas susceptibles a ataques de fuerza bruta o phishing.

  6. Gestión de Cambios: En entornos dinámicos donde los roles de los usuarios cambian frecuentemente, la falta de actualización oportuna de las políticas de IAM puede resultar en accesos obsoletos o innecesarios que amplían la superficie de ataque.

  7. Delegación de Permisos: El uso de roles y la capacidad de delegar permisos a través de políticas de IAM puede ser complicado y, si se hace incorrectamente, puede dar lugar a brechas de seguridad inadvertidas.

Debido a estos factores, las políticas de IAM deben ser diseñadas, implementadas y mantenidas con un alto nivel de cuidado y conocimiento de las prácticas de seguridad. Una gestión inadecuada de estas políticas puede abrir la puerta a vulnerabilidades críticas que los atacantes pueden explotar para comprometer la infraestructura de AWS, acceder a datos confidenciales, y potencialmente tomar control de los servicios y aplicaciones en la nube.

Última actualización